From ef8f045ff95982449b8bdf3d2a24e7412a57cc40 Mon Sep 17 00:00:00 2001 From: Edward Hervey Date: Tue, 29 Jan 2019 12:01:59 +0100 Subject: [PATCH] test: Set PTS on proper variable This would previously set the PTS on a random address causing various memory corruption --- tests/check/libs/baseparse.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/tests/check/libs/baseparse.c b/tests/check/libs/baseparse.c index 9db1412..576cae3 100644 --- a/tests/check/libs/baseparse.c +++ b/tests/check/libs/baseparse.c @@ -505,7 +505,7 @@ _src_getrange_pull_short_read (GstPad * pad, GstObject * parent, memcpy (data, &raw_buffer[offset], buffer_size); buf = gst_buffer_new_wrapped (data, buffer_size); - GST_BUFFER_PTS (buffer) = + GST_BUFFER_PTS (buf) = gst_util_uint64_scale_round (buffer_pull_count, GST_SECOND * TEST_VIDEO_FPS_D, TEST_VIDEO_FPS_N); GST_BUFFER_DURATION (buf) = -- 2.7.4